How Our Carpet Water Extraction Process Works
At our company, we understand the importance of a proper process with Carpet Water Extraction. That’s why we’ve developed a step-by-step approach that ensures your carpets are thoroughly dried and restored to their original condition. Our process includes:
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will assess the damage and create a customized plan to extract the water and dry your carpets. We’ll identify the source of the leak and take steps to pr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use advanced equipment to extract as much water as possible from your carpets, including our powerful truck-mounted extractors and portable pumps.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use industrial-grade drying equipment to dry your carpets and dehumidify the air to prevent further moisture buildup.
Step 4: Disinfection and Sanitizing
We’ll disinfect and sanitize your carpets to prevent the growth of mold and mildew.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leaning
We’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ure your carpets are dry and clean, and we’ll provide a thorough cleaning to remove any remaining dirt and debris.

Carpet Water Extraction Cost in Van Alstyne, TX
The cost of Carpet Water Extraction can vary depending on the severity and size of the affected area. On average, you can expect to pay between $500 and $2,500 for a standard extraction service. But, prices can range from $1,000 to $5,000 or more for larger or more complex jobs.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Standard Extraction Service |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ed. |
| Advanced Drying Service | $1,000 – $3,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ed. |
| Disinfection and Sanitizing Service |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area and severity of damage. |
| Final Inspection and Cleaning Service |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area and severity of damage. |
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ment, and we offer free estimates to ensure you get the best value for your money.

Common Questions About Carpet Water Extraction
How long does it take to extract water from carpets?
Our team can typically extract water from carpets within 60 minutes to 3 hours, depending on the size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
Can I use a wet vacuum to extract water from my carpets?
While a wet vacuum can be helpful in extracting some water, it’s not enough to fully dry your carpets. Our team uses advanced equipment to extract as much water as possible and dry your carpets thoroughly.
Will I need to replace my carpets after water damage?
It depends on the severity of the damage. In some cases, our team can restore your carpets to their original condition. But, if the damage is extensive, we may recommend replacing your carpets for safety and hygiene reasons.
How can I prevent water damage in the future?
Regular maintenance, such as checking your gutters and downspouts, and addressing any leaks or water stains quickly, can help prevent water damage. You can also consider installing a sump pump or a backup power source to ensure your home stays dry during power outages.
